I made the mistake of becoming somewhat familiar with EOF
(empirical orthogonal function) analysis recently. As a
result, I have been asked to investigate the possibility
of doing "rotated" EOF analysis. In this technique, you
take a handful of the eigenvectors that come out of the
EOF analysis, and rotate them in a way that reapportions
the variance between them. The most popular rotation
method is called "varimax rotation." This is apparently
the method used in a Matlab command named roteofs.
